在大学一直搞是单片机,写是嵌入式C语言程序,走过了不少弯路,现在感觉仍然在走弯路。有幸偶尔看到了这篇文章,深感自己以前写程序时候存在很多误区。现写篇博客做下总结。第一篇 软件架构篇1.1 模块划分模块划分 “划” 是规划意思,意指怎样合理将一个很大软件划分为一系列功能独立部分合作完成系统需求。C 语言作为一种结构化程序设计语言,在程序划分上主要依据功能,C语言模块化程序设计需
转载 2024-06-03 12:48:00
47阅读
提示:文章写完后,目录可以自动生成,如何生成可参考右边帮助文档 文章目录前言一、大体框架构建二、构建棋盘三、布置雷四、排雷五、递归展开六、判断输赢总结 前言扫雷是一个比较经典游戏,而通过c语言将游戏做出来,是对c语言函数,循环,库函数,数组知识点一个很好考验。本篇文章主要讲解如何用C语言实现扫雷游戏一个逻辑运行,其中主要准备采用多文件执行,即game.h、game.c、test.c分别
转载 2023-07-16 23:22:35
84阅读
嗨喽,大家好,我是程序猿老王,程序猿老王就是我。今天给大家讲一讲C语言简介。C语言是一种通用高级程序设计语言,由美国贝尔实验室Dennis M. Ritchie于1972年开发。C语言设计目标是提供高效系统级编程语言,同时保持简单、可读性强和可移植性等特点。C语言语法和结构相对简单,易于学习和使用,因此广泛应用于操作系统、编译器、数据库、图形用户界面、网络协议、嵌入式系统等领域。C语言
转载 2023-11-18 21:04:49
168阅读
目录1. C语言程序框架1.1. 程序编译过程1.2. C语言程序结构分析1. C语言程序框架        C程序一般由头文件、主函数和函数三部分组成;从最简单程序开始,对于大多数程序语言,第一个入门编程代码便是"Hello World!",一步一步分析程序编写到编译是进行一个什么样过程,程序如下所示:#
给位帅哥靓女们,今天猪猪我和大叫来说说c语言语言结构,如果有错误地方还请评论区斧正。猪猪码字不易,如果觉得猪猪写可以的话,还请一件三连。众所周知,c语言是结构化程序设计语言,其结构分为三大块,顺序结构,选择结构,循环结构,那我们按照顺序来一个个解析他们。【顺序结构】在我们编写代码时候,我们都是从上到下编写,如果没有选择结构或者是循环结构的话,程序也是从上到下运行,这就是所谓顺序结构
很长时间以来,都是在用C语言写东西。也一直在思考,如何能很好掌握C,查过很多资料,也作过一些尝试,于是整理成此文。在大部分情况下,我们会写或者使用一个C库,然后被应用程序使用,运行在Linux系统上。于是,就有了基于C语言知识结构:App ------------------- C API C, libc ------------------- Posix API L
转载 2024-02-26 13:16:34
100阅读
分支&循环超全超细知识点总结!大家好,这里是瑶瑶子,一个努力学习计算机知识大学生,在这里分享自己学习内容,希望分享知识和内容能够对你们有帮助。可能存在理解不深刻、全面,说法不准确地方,希望给出宝贵建议,让我们共同进步和成长!知识体系导图 图片: 分支和循环分支&循环超全超细知识点总结!C语言结构(三种)分支语句1、if语句2、switch-case语句循环语句1、whil
转载 2024-03-03 07:52:01
429阅读
一、信息架构是企业架构重要组成部分二、什么是信息/数据架构先看看大咖是怎么定义。•DAMA:定义了与组织战略协调管理数据资产蓝图,指导基于组织战略目标,指定符合战略需求数据架构。•IBM:数据架构是用来描述企业数据源在哪里,哪些数据是可信,这些数据是如何存储,以及数据在不同系统中是如何使用和集成一整套组件。信息架构定义:数据架构是企业架构一部分,企业级数据架构是以结构化方式描
C语言组成一、C语言写工程、项目 一个项目会由多个模块组成,每个模块之间是相对独立,每个模块是由0个或多个**.c和.h**组成,各个模块之间可以分开编码研发。 如果继续一个**.c文件去编写,各个模块之间不能分开编码研发—>需要分为多个.c** 一般来说哦,每写一个**.c文件对应写一个.h**文件 .c文件里面写是实现某个模块里函数 .h里面写**.c**文件中函数声明、类型声明…
转载 2024-06-22 21:30:10
175阅读
学习C语言二,C语言四大基本结构 还有下视频在我B站主页找。概要:C语言四种基本结构是很重要,程序主要是由这些结构组成,学完这些结构,便可以写一些基本程序。。一,四种基本结构 二,四种基本结构精析        一.分支结构(if-else)if(表达式){ 语句组1; } else{ 语句组2; }1.1首先,if(
转载 2023-07-17 20:40:51
227阅读
 NPU架构与算力分析参考文献链接https://mp.weixin.qq.com/s/xc_-5SmtWLGQuX3w-ptPfAhttps://mp.weixin.qq.com/s/samT5gYMsrwBguvMTHbS9Qhttps://mp.weixin.qq.com/s/uJkAhJzUpGeyYvO92p4-Owhttps://mp.weixin.qq.com/s/BRY2
# 如何实现NP体系架构 NP(Node-Express-PostgreSQL)体系架构是一种常见全栈技术栈,通常用于构建高效Web应用程序。下面我们将详细介绍如何实现这一架构,并提供相关代码示例和注释。 ## 实现流程 以下是实现NP体系架构基本步骤: | 步骤 | 描述 | |---------|----------
原创 8月前
48阅读
SH506是一款具有用于智能硬件产品神经网络加速(NPU)专业AI SoC。它支持720p 30fps高质量数字视频录制和回放。 NPU在深度神经网络推断上可提供最高至0.6TOP计算性能。典型应用包括对象/指尖/脸部识别,OCR,人体姿势分析和情绪评估等。采用Neon技术和FPUarm Cortex-A7 MP2处理器在开发定制应用程序时提供了丰富通用计算资源。具有3D降
不同编程语言有不同程序结构和自己语法,在学习C语言之前就要知道它程序结构还有它基本语法。不了解这些你程序只会不停报错而你又不知道哪里出了问题。例如只是一个小小";"忘记了写程序就无法运行。下面我们来看看一个最简单C程序结构。Hello World实例首先,先说明C语言程序组成主要有下面几个部分:1.预处理命令 2.函数 3.变量 4.语句和表达式 5.注释接下来我们来分析代码
HTML系统架构:B/S架构:Browser / Server (浏览器/服务器交互形式)Browser支持语言:HTML 、CSS 、JavaScriptS是服务器端Server,Server端支持语言CC++ 、Java 、python....B/S架构优缺点:优点:升级方便,只是升级服务器端代码即可。维护成本低。缺点:速度慢,体验不好,界面不炫酷。 C/S架构:Clien
转载 2023-07-10 21:46:34
88阅读
前言        学习C语言,必须要掌握是三大结构——顺序、分支和循环。一切C语言程序都可以用这三个结构总结,因此熟练掌握它们,对于写程序以及理解程序都是非常有必要。目录顺序结构变量声明函数声明循环结构whiledo-while for breakcontinue分支结构if....else.
np.r_是按列连接两个矩阵,就是把两矩阵上下相加,要求列数相等。np.c_是按行连接两个矩阵,就是把两矩阵左右相加,要求行数相等。1、np.c_ 用法:a = np.array([[1, 2, 3],[7,8,9]]) b=np.array([[4,5,6],[1,2,3]]) aOut[4]: array([[1, 2, 3], [7, 8, 9]...
原创 2019-04-10 17:10:08
728阅读
一、Hello World#include<stdio.h> int main() { printf("Hello World"); return 0; }        作者从一段最简单C语言代码开始说起,这段代码输出是“Hello World”。作者使用是VS2019编译器。那么我们该如何理解这
目录前言拓展知识介绍system("pause")First:制作可控移动小蛇Second:添加食物Third:如何Game Over完整代码 前言声明:本游戏参考《c语言课程设计与游戏开发实践教程》。 这个小游戏尤其可以加深对整体循环、二维数组理解。我将用循序渐进步骤制作。如果想直接学习完整代码,目录最后一条可直接查看完整代码(带解析)。 先来放一个游戏效果视
C语言底层逻辑剖析(分支与循环1)导入关于C语言底层逻辑剖析,此系列我们就要正式进入C语言深入学习,关于学编程这件事呢,其实还是那句话,学习编程这件事是极其枯燥也是非常困难,但是要相信坚持一定会有收获,共勉。语句什么是语句? 在C语言中大致有以下几种语句1.表达式语句; 2.函数调用语句; 3.控制语句; 4.复合语句; 5.空语句;这5种语句中最为重要的当属第三种控制语句,控制语句是用来
  • 1
  • 2
  • 3
  • 4
  • 5